Output 28703faabeb5d40d6ae16bbe0fabfb0176da3c69ab98b1c2411575845f9eaaf1:54

value
393733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e178a2d04e2762e5045257c4559202e39ef46b6 OP_EQUAL
address
3EeL5MVaBL4YgNe2g343Gz7PmisvCg3ymX
transaction
28703faabeb5d40d6ae16bbe0fabfb0176da3c69ab98b1c2411575845f9eaaf1
confirmations
192265
spent
true